TECO VHP4004FP:

  • 400 HP
  • 444 Motor FLA
  • 460 V
  • 1800 RPM
  • 449TP Frame
  • Weather Protected I (WP1)
  • Three Phase
  • 95.8% Efficiency
  • 88.5% Power Factor

TECO Series

VERTICAL HOLLOW SHAFT WPI FIRE PUMP

APPLICATIONS:

  • Deep Well Turbine Pumps
  • Fluid Handling Systems
  • Irrigation
  • Water/Waste Water
  • Fire Pumps

Features

FEATURES:

  • Output Range: 7.5 - 800 HP
  • Speed: 1800 RPM
  • Enclosure: Weather Protected Type I (WPI)
  • Voltage: 230/460V (Usable on 208V); 150HP and Larger is 460V Only
  • Three Phase, 60 Hz, 1.15 Service Factor (Continuous on Sine Wave Power)
  • Inverter Duty (PWM) per NEMA MG-1 Part 31 at 1.0 Service Factor
  • New Dual Column (60/50 Hz) Design Nameplate as Standard; 50 Hz Data 190/380V at 1.0 S.F.
  • Standard Features: Coupling w/ Gib Key, Ball Type NRR, Drip/Splash Cover, Space Heaters (120V)
  • 5000 Frames and Above also include Mounting Provisions for bearing RTD's and Insulated Bearing Housing
  • Optional Capability for 175% High Thrust Requirement for 444 - 449TP Frames
  • Motor Design Suitable to handle 2 stacked bearings; Motors will ship with 1 bearing and 1 spacer as Standard
  • Class F Insulation with Phenolic Alkyd Resin Varnish
  • Class B Temperature Rise
  • NEMA Design B Torques
  • Designed for 40 degrees C Ambient Temperature
  • Designed for 3300 ft. Elevation
  • Counterclockwise (CCW) Rotation; Viewed from Top
  • Cast Iron Frame & End Brackets
  • 1045 Hollow Carbon Steel Shaft
  • Suitable for Inverter Use per NEMA MG-1 Part 31.4.4.2, 10:1 Variable Torque with NRR, 10:1 C.T., 20:1 VT without NRR Using Braking in VFD
  • Precautions should be taken to eliminate or reduce shaft currents that may be imposed on the motor by VFD at stated per NEMA MG-1, part 31 for AMRCNH and Part 30 for AMRC.
